What You’ll Do… 

Relocity is seeking a Director of Customer Success & Implementations to lead and scale a critical, highly cross-functional function responsible for both client success and delivery. This role leads the client lifecycle across implementation, onboarding, and ongoing customer success, partnering with Sales during pre-sale solutioning and demo readiness to ensure continuity from initial engagement through delivery and long-term success.

You will lead a small, high-impact team while defining and operationalizing a more structured and scalable Customer Success & Implementations function. This role sits at the intersection of client experience, product, and delivery, ensuring Relocity can support a highly customized, non–plug-and-play product in a consistent and sustainable way.

This is a player-coach role, requiring a leader who can operate strategically while staying close to the work, particularly across high-profile enterprise accounts and complex client scenarios.

This role is ideal for someone who thrives in building structure within complexity and is energized by operating at the intersection of strategy and execution.

What Past Experience and Current Skills Will Enable Your Success In This Role?
  • 8+ years in Customer Success, Account Management, and/or Implementations within a SaaS or technology-enabled services environment,  and you're ready to step into a bigger leadership seat, whether or not you've held the Director title before
  • You've lived the full client lifecycle - pre-sale support, onboarding, implementation, and ongoing success,  and you understand how early decisions ripple into long-term outcomes
  • You've led and developed people, even in lean environments where you're still close to the work; player-coach isn't a buzzword, it's how you already operate
  • You build structure inside ambiguity - when processes are unclear or breaking under growth, you find the pattern, propose the system, and bring people along
  • You're fluent in complex, non-standard implementations and know how to manage highly customized client solutions without losing the thread on scope, timelines, or the relationship
  • You're technical enough to be dangerous - comfortable with integrations, APIs, and system configurations, and able to translate between what a client wants and what's actually buildable
  • You stay calm when things get loud - escalations, competing priorities, and high-pressure moments are where you do some of your best work
  • You partner cross-functionally with Product, Engineering, and Sales - co-owning outcomes, not just handing off tickets
  • You move at the pace of the work - adaptable, proactive, and energized (not drained) by shifting priorities in a fast-moving environment

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
